Heathrow Express

About
The Heathrow Express is a train service from the United Kingdom that operates between London Heathrow Airport and Paddington Station in London. It runs every 15 minutes from 5:10am to 11:25pm, with a journey time of just 15 minutes. The train service offers two types of trains: the Express Class and the Business First Class. Express Class offers comfortable seating, free Wi-Fi, and power sockets, while Business First Class offers extra legroom, complimentary newspapers, and complimentary refreshments. There are three types of tickets available: Single, Return, and Group. Onboard facilities include a café bar, luggage storage, and a quiet zone. The most popular routes for the Heathrow Express are London Heathrow Airport to Paddington Station, and Paddington Station to London Heathrow Airport.
